Notes to SEFA
The accompanying schedule of expenditures of federal and state awards (“SEFSA” or “Schedule”) includes the federal and state grant activity of the Food Bank of Central & Eastern North Carolina, Inc. and Affiliate (the “Organization”), under the programs of the federal and state government for the year ended June 30, 2025. The information in this SEFSA is presented in accordance with the requirements of Title 2 U.S. Code of Federal Regulations Part 200, Uniform Administrative Requirements, Cost Principles, and Audit Requirements for Federal Awards and the NC GS Sections 143C-6-23 and 09 NCAC 03M requirements. Because the Schedule presents only a selected portion of the operations of the Organization, it is not intended to, and does not, present the financial position, changes in net assets, or cash flows of the Organization.
Food commodities are expended when distributed to agencies. Distributed food is reported in the SEFSA under the Commodity Supplemental Food Program and the Emergency Food Assistance Program and is valued at the weighted-average wholesale value of one pound of donated product based on the national per pound price ($1.72) as provided by the most recent Feeding America Product Valuation Survey for the calendar year 2024.
